The initial situation involves selling $50$ mangoes for $₹30$ with a $10\%$ loss.
We can write this as an equation:
$SP = 0.90 \times CP$
$₹30 = 0.90 \times CP$
Now, solve for $CP$:
$CP = \frac{₹30}{0.90} = \frac{300}{9} = \frac{100}{3}$
So, the Cost Price ($CP$) for $50$ mangoes is $₹\frac{100}{3}$.
The goal is to achieve a $20\%$ gain.
Calculate the target $SP$ for $50$ mangoes:
$SP_{target} = 1.20 \times CP$
$SP_{target} = 1.20 \times ₹\frac{100}{3} = \frac{12}{10} \times \frac{100}{3} = \frac{4}{10} \times 100 = ₹40$
Therefore, to gain $20\%$, $50$ mangoes must be sold for $₹40$.
We need to find out how many mangoes should be sold for $₹28$ to achieve the $20\%$ gain.
We know:
Let $x$ be the number of mangoes to be sold for $₹28$. We can use a proportion:
$\frac{\text{Number of Mangoes}}{\text{Selling Price}} = \text{constant}$
$\frac{50}{₹40} = \frac{x}{₹28}$
Solve for $x$:
$x = \frac{50 \times 28}{40} = \frac{5 \times 28}{4} = 5 \times 7 = 35$
Thus, $35$ mangoes should be sold for $₹28$ to gain $20\%$.
